Oman's unique geography, characterized by vast coastal lines and arid deserts, presents a severe challenge for traditional fencing. The high salinity in coastal areas like Muscat and Salalah causes rapid oxidation of standard materials, making the demand for high-grade wire mesh fence systems critical for infrastructure longevity.
Current market trends show a shift toward "anti-climb" and "anti-cut" specifications. As Oman expands its industrial zones and oil & gas facilities, the adoption of the 358 mesh fence has increased significantly due to its small apertures that prevent finger or tool insertion, meeting strict international security standards.
Furthermore, the booming construction sector in the region requires robust reinforcement. The integration of specialized construction wire mesh is now standard in building foundations and concrete reinforcement to withstand the thermal expansion and contraction caused by extreme temperature fluctuations.
